WebbThe letter “b” is used for 1st inversion and the letter “c” is used for 2nd inversion. So: Ib = Chord I in its 1st inversion Ic = Chord I in its 2nd inversion Popular Music In popular music you will often see chord symbols like G/B. This says that a G chord should be played with a B at the bottom (a G triad in first inversion). tom\u0027s italian menuWebbChord inversions add a richness to a chord progression and are a great tool for composers to use.
